Dallas Stars Dominate Chicago Blackhawks 8-1, Marchment Scores Hat Trick
Stars continue winning streak at home as Blackhawks struggle on the road.
- Mason Marchment scored his second career hat trick and added an assist in the Dallas Stars' 8-1 win over the Chicago Blackhawks.
- Dallas Stars are now 7-1-1 in their past nine games, with this win marking their sixth consecutive home victory.
- Tyler Seguin contributed a goal and two assists for Dallas, while Roope Hintz scored his fourth goal in two games.
- Chicago Blackhawks have now lost four-of-five overall and 11 straight on the road.
- Connor Bedard, Chicago’s 18-year-old star, assisted on the power-play goal for his rookie-leading 33rd point.
